Frequently Asked Questions For TTR 110 Exhaust System

Upgrading to a performance exhaust system for the TTR 110 can enhance the bike's overall performance by improving airflow, which can lead to increased horsepower and torque. Additionally, a performance exhaust can reduce weight compared to the stock system, contributing to better handling and agility. Riders may also appreciate the improved sound and aesthetics that come with a new exhaust system.

When selecting an exhaust system for a TTR 110, consider factors such as the intended use of the bike, whether for casual riding, racing, or off-road. Look for systems that are compatible with your specific model year and check for features like weight reduction, sound level, and any additional performance benefits. It's also important to consider the material of the exhaust, as options like stainless steel or aluminum can impact durability and weight.

While an aftermarket exhaust system can enhance performance, its impact on fuel efficiency can vary. In some cases, improved airflow can lead to better combustion and potentially increased fuel efficiency, especially if the bike is tuned to match the new exhaust. However, if the bike is ridden aggressively or modified significantly, fuel efficiency may not improve and could even decrease.

Common materials used in TTR 110 exhaust systems include stainless steel, aluminum, and titanium. Stainless steel is known for its durability and resistance to corrosion, while aluminum is lighter and often more affordable. Titanium is the lightest option and offers excellent strength but can be more expensive. Each material has its pros and cons, so consider your riding style and conditions when choosing.

An aftermarket exhaust system can significantly alter the sound profile of a TTR 110. Performance exhausts are designed to produce a deeper, more aggressive tone compared to stock systems, which can enhance the overall riding experience. However, the sound level can vary widely between different systems, so it's important to choose one that meets your preferences and local noise regulations.

When considering installation of a TTR 110 exhaust system, check if the system is designed for easy bolt-on installation or if it requires modifications. Look for systems that come with all necessary hardware and detailed instructions. Additionally, consider whether you have the tools and skills for installation, or if you might need professional help.

Yes, upgrading to an aftermarket exhaust system can significantly reduce the weight of the TTR 110. Many performance exhausts are designed to be lighter than stock systems, which can improve handling and maneuverability. A lighter bike can also enhance acceleration and overall performance, making weight a crucial factor in your choice of exhaust.

While there are many benefits to installing an aftermarket exhaust system, potential downsides include increased noise levels, which may not be suitable for all riding environments. Additionally, some systems may require tuning or adjustments to the bike's fuel mapping to achieve optimal performance. It's also important to consider the warranty implications, as some aftermarket modifications may void manufacturer warranties.
